Hey guys! :)
First I have a question: Is it possible to set a layer which is a white circle as a bounding box?
I think a good idea for a function would be to make it possible to set the bounding box (which could be a layer with a white circle) as the printing box. Afterwards it should then be possible (like it is right now) to set the print size to any size like 120mm x 120mm.
What do you think?
I would love to see that function because I need it for a few months now.
THANKS for doing all the stuff happening guys! You ARE awesome.
0 Votes
rady kal posted about 4 years ago Admin Best Answer
1. No bounding boxes can only be rectangular.
2. You can use the printing box as bounding box.

rady kal posted about 4 years ago Admin
The bounding box can't be used as printing box. You need to set the printing box first and then you can enable that the printing box should be used as bounding box. The result is the same.
You can only have rectangular bounding boxes but you can use shaped svg masks if you like or put a semi transparent layer on top in the shape you like to get.
